A ZigBee PRO software stack designed to run on the JN5139 32-bit single-chip wireless microcontroller supports both embedded single-chip and co-processor configurations. When operating as an embedded single chip, the software stack and processor provide a high-performance, feature-rich implementation that accommodates both the ZigBee PRO protocol and the user’s application. As a co-processor, it allows ZigBee PRO networking functionality to be easily added to existing designs and applications. To accelerate time to market, ZigBee PRO is also offered with Jennic’s comprehensive range of FCC- and ETSI-certified modules, eliminating RF design complexity.
